The Heraldry of the Methe Surname: A Look at Coat of Arms and Family History

The surname Methe is said to be derived from a nickname, 'the methe,' which means courteous. This connection to courtesy is evident in historical texts such as 'Thou was methe and meke' from the Cursor Mundi, as noted by Halliwell. The name has been found in various records throughout history, with individuals such as Henry Methe in Suffolk in 1273 and John Methe in Salop.

One notable mention of the surname is the baptism of Anne, daughter of Thomas Mythe, in St. James, Clerkenwell in 1616. This highlights the presence of the Methe family in different regions of England over the centuries. The significance of the name is further emphasized in A Dictionary of English and Welsh Surnames (1896) by Charles Wareing Endell Bardsley.
